Purpose of the Job:

Assist in the administration of the Business Loan portfolio within the framework of the approved credit management policies as set by the Board, to ensure the loan assets represent acceptable risk and return to the Credit Union.

Job Summary

You will be part of the Business Banking Credit team that has responsibility for credit decisions pertaining to a $7 billion Business loan portfolio across all sectors of the Canadian economy. Key sectors include Land & Construction, Hospitality, Income Producing Real Estate and general industries. This position will be responsible for supporting the Director Business Credit that manages a team of Business Credit adjudicators. You will provide credit adjudication, portfolio management and act as a key business partner to the Business Banking Delivery team. This is to be done within the framework of the approved credit management policies as set by the Board, to ensure the loan assets represent acceptable risk and return to the Credit Union. Knowledge, Skills and Experience:

  • Minimum three years experience in Business Credit underwriting and risk management in a financial services environment, combined with relevant post-secondary education with an emphasis on business and finance (i.e. Bachelors or Masters in Business Administration, Finance, Accounting).
  • Understanding of business sectors (including leveraged & private equity, out & in-bound syndications, mortgage / leasing / bulk finance entities) and corporate structures (i.e. Partnerships, LLP, REITS, Trusts) would be an asset.
  • Prior experience in income property lending, land, development & construction, and hospitality sectors would be an asset.
  • Familiarity with acceptable financing options and techniques (i.e. senior, mezzanine, subordinate debt, share and other equity offerings)
  • Sound understanding and ability to deeply assess business financial statements, conduct cash flow analysis and work with financial models to prepare various down case scenarios / stress testing of Member forecasts.
  • Sound understanding of commercial lending security documentation, including collection / work out techniques and remedies.
  • Knowledge of commercial account operating procedures, cash management services and other banking products (i.e. credit cards, forex, automated funds transfers) is preferred.

Who we are:

Meridian is Ontario’s largest credit union, and second largest in Canada, helping to grow the lives of our more than 360,000 Members. Meridian has more than 75 years of banking history and is 100% owned by its members. With 89 retail branches and 15 Business Banking Centers across Ontario and $ 30B in assets under management, Meridian offers a full range of financial products and services to its retail, business banking and wealth members. With over 2000 employees and corporate offices located in Toronto and St. Catharines, Meridian has a track record of creating and delivering innovative new offerings and is committed to investing in the communities that we serve.
